About the role: As a Driver for Arnold Clark, it will be your job to deliver cars to and from our branches. You'll also help with handing vehicles over to our customers accepting delivery of their new contract hire vehicles. This is a customer facing role that would ideally suit somebody with a positive and friendly attitude, who is an experienced driver and has a genuine drive to exceed customer expectations.
Day-to-day duties:
- Delivering cars to other branches
- Delivering and collecting lease cars from our customers
- Demonstrating the basic vehicle controls on new vehicles
- Inspecting our end of lease cars
Essential skills:
- A full, clean driving licence held for a minimum of one year
- Fantastic customer service skills
- The ability to work as part of a team
- Attention to detail
- Basic computer and mobile device knowledge
- A high level of accuracy in checking cars
